A Vessel of Use

2 Timothy 2:19-21
Nevertheless the foundation of God standeth sure, having this seal, The Lord knoweth them that are his. And, Let every one that nameth the name of Christ depart from iniquity
But in a great house there are not only vessels of gold and of silver, but also of wood and of earth; and some to honour, and some to dishonor.
If a man therefore purge himself from these, he shall be a vessel unto honour, sanctified, and meet for the master's use, and prepared unto every good work.

What does it mean to be a vessel of use? What do I need to do to be a vessel of use for God? These questions have ran through my mind many times. I want to be a vessel of use for God, but how do I become that vessel?
According to this scripture, in order to be a vessel of honor I must turn away from sin. I must purge my heart of all of the things that hold me back. I must turn  my life to the master. That is the only way that I can be a vessel that is sanctified and meet for the master's use.
